Summary, notice description and lot information
The London Borough of Camden Council is extending the contracts for its Young People's Pathway Services, originally awarded in November 2018, for care-experienced young people aged 16-25. This short-term extension ranges from 4 to 8 months, aligning end dates to 31 May 2026. The pathway services fall under the social work services with accommodation category (CPV code 85311000) and are located in the London Borough of Camden (specific region: UKI31).
The current procurement stage is in the 'Award' phase with the contracts having been signed on 21 March 2025. The procurement method was negotiated without publication of a contract notice due to the repetition of existing services under the directive conditions. This is not a new contract opportunity, but rather a VEAT notice to inform the market that the Contracting Authority is seeking to extend its existing contracts for its Young People's Pathway which were awarded in November 2018 and are due to expire on either 30 September 2025, 31 October 2025, 31 December 2025 and 31 January 2026. The extension period will range between four and eight months co-aligning end dates to 31 May 2026. The extension will enable the authority to continue to develop plans for the new services and will tender services in 2025/2026.
